7

私たちのコードには、ifdefされたパッセージがたくさんあります。以前のバージョンのVisualStudioでは、それらはグレー表示されていました。ただし、Visual Studio 2012では、これらはグレー表示されなくなり、淡色表示になります。つまり、これらのパッセージは、構文の強調表示スキームのすべての色で表示されますが、彩度の低い色で表示されます。これを実装したMicrosoftのプログラマーは、これを非常にクールだと思っていたに違いありませんが、実際には、パッセージがアクティブか非アクティブかを判断するのは非常に困難です。

Visual Studio 2012をだまして、非アクティブなパッセージをグレー表示する古い方法を使用する方法を見つけた人はいますか?

返信ありがとうございます

4

1 に答える 1

8

Opacity変更できる設定があります。

Tools -> Options -> Text Editor -> C/C++ -> Formatting 変更できますInactive Code Opacity Percent。デフォルトは65ですが、これより高い値に変更してください。
または、これを完全にキャンセルする場合は、をに
設定します。Disable Inactive Code OpacityTrue

ここに画像の説明を入力してください

于 2013-03-13T11:04:50.977 に答える